TPS65981: Can TPS6981 configure through I2C interface, not an external SPI flash memory for application code?

Part Number: TPS65981

Dear Sir/Madam

From datasheet of TPS65981, it is need an external SPI flash memory for application code. And its I2C inerface can be used to update the Firmware.

If there is a processor (ARM) on the board, which can control TPS65981 through I2C interface. Does TPS65981 can be configured by the processor through I2C interface? 

If the answer is "yes", the external SPI flash can be not needed on our board. This will save cost of the BOM.

Please advise me whether this way is possible (program TPS65981 through I2C interface) or not.
